Moving forward, learning to program my first logical switch, it is been used in conjunction with the accelerometer in the Y axis to announce the remaining flight time when tild forward, the logical switch is using the retract switch to turn it on and off, when the gear is down the logical switch is off and on when gear is up, this prevents any announcements before the gear goes up on TO.

Thanks to my friend Raffy for showing me how to set it up, I have added the L switch to my other two jets.

Personally my idea is to not do that at all. I always want independent control of such functions as there are just too many things that can happen such as a flame out where I'm going to need to land off field and I want flaps until the last second to lose as much speed as possible but want the gear retracted. Or the wind picks up and I decide it's best to land without any flaps, etc. Granted, the vast majority of the time it would be no problem but to not have those options if needed sounds like a bad idea to me.
